Educate Rochdale Awards 2024
Fri 19 Jul 2024First Ever Educate Rochdale Awards!
We are thrilled to announce the launch of the borough’s first ever Educate Rochdale Awards sponsored by Reed Education.
These inaugural awards shine a spotlight on outstanding achievements and contributions within the field of education. They are a celebration of all the exemplary work taking place in our schools and colleges.
Educate Rochdale Awards aim to build an inspirational and inclusive legacy that will resonate across our community, celebrating Rochdale’s education heroes and fostering a culture of excellence and continuous improvement.
The winners will be revealed at a special ceremony on Friday 8th November 2024 at Rochdale Town Hall where that hard work will be recognised in an evening filled with passion and energy.
Educate Rochdale Awards 2024 looks set to be a truly special evening which will uplift and inspire, celebrating the tremendous work of our educators, acknowledging the dedication, innovation, and commitment of individuals who inspire and uplift our school communities on a daily basis.

How to enter
We believe that it’s vital to celebrate everything that’s fantastic about education and schooling in Rochdale and we are looking forward to seeing nominations for incredible work. NB: All schools and colleges across the borough are invited to enter. Entries are invited from school staff, parents, pupils, governors and anyone with knowledge of a particular school or education establishment.
Entries that exemplify the talent, innovation and commitment of our educators across all aspects of school and college life are encouraged.
We would love for every school and college to be involved by nominating your most deserving candidates and joining us in marking the achievements of our school communities. Entries must be submitted by 31st August 2024 via https://consultations.rochdale.gov.uk/research/education-awards-2024/
If you, your colleague, team or school achieved something really special during the 2023/24 academic year then we want to hear about it!
A glittering celebration
The awards event itself will be a glitzy celebration and will include a very special meal served in the impressive Great Hall at Rochdale’s newly restored Town Hall.
There will be 3 shortlisted nominees per award and each shortlisted school or college will receive 2 free tickets. Further tickets will then go on open sale in September.
Reed Education have generously agreed to be the headline sponsor of Educate Rochdale Awards and each individual award is also being sponsored by local businesses. Each sponsor will be instrumental in the shortlisting process and the presentation of the awards.

Visit from John Pridmore
Wed 26 Jun 2024Our Year 9 & 10 students were able to listen to John Pridmore last week, sharing the story of how his life has changed, including the time he spent with Mother Teresa, Princess Diana etc and his journey to finding God. The students asked some excellent questions!

Year 10 Mock Interview Day
Fri 14 Jun 2024We welcomed visitors to school today to support our Year 10 mock interviews - local employers, colleges and the Police. All of our Year 10 students worked hard to complete their CVs in preparation for their Mock Interview.
The buzz in the main hall was great to see. Well done to those Year 10 who completed their interviews, a credit to Holy Family College with lots of positive feedback from our visitors!
